Upton Hall Fun Day

Upton Hall in Nottinghamshire, the headquarters of the British Horological Institute, is having a fun day on Saturday 12th September. The current grade II* listed hall was built in 1828, also houses the Museum of Timekeeping. RAF Waddington Amateur Radio Club will be operating their radios (callsign G0RAF) to promote the event.

18th October 2024: talk by Nigel Limb

Mark your diaries and come along to the Pyewipe shack for what promises to be a fascinating talk by Nigel, who survived after his life support was turned off following a motorcycle crash. Since then, Nigel has gained his Foundation licence and broken motorcycle speed records, despite loss of vision and a brain injury!
